scsi: ufs: Add a bsg endpoint that supports UPIUs
For now, just provide an API to allocate and remove ufs-bsg node. We will use this framework to manage ufs devices by sending UPIU transactions. For the time being, implements an empty bsg_request() - will add some more functionality in coming patches. Nonetheless, we reveal here the protocol we are planning to use: UFS Transport Protocol Transactions. UFS transactions consist of packets called UFS Protocol Information Units (UPIU). There are UPIU’s defined for UFS SCSI commands, responses, data in and data out, task management, utility functions, vendor functions, transaction synchronization and control, and more. By using UPIUs, we get access to the most fine-grained internals of this protocol, and able to communicate with the device in ways, that are sometimes beyond the capacity of the ufs driver. Moreover and as a result, our core structure - ufs_bsg_node has a pretty lean structure: using upiu transactions that contains the outmost detailed info, so we don't really need complex constructs to support it. +config SCSI_UFS_BSG
+ bool "Universal Flash Storage BSG device node"
+ depends on SCSI_UFSHCD
+ select BLK_DEV_BSGLIB
+ help
+ Universal Flash Storage (UFS) is SCSI transport specification for
+ accessing flash storage on digital cameras, mobile phones and
+ consumer electronic devices.
+ A UFS controller communicates with a UFS device by exchanging
+ UFS Protocol Information Units (UPIUs).
+ UPIUs can not only be used as a transport layer for the SCSI protocol
+ but are also used by the UFS native command set.
+ This transport driver supports exchanging UFS protocol information units
+ with a UFS device. See also the ufshcd driver, which is a SCSI driver
+ that supports UFS devices.
+
+ Select this if you need a bsg device node for your UFS controller.
+ If unsure, say N.
